MELBOURNE — Day 3 at the Australian Open was chaos at its finest with two veterans making improbably comebacks, and a young, new face making a name for herself.

Jo-Wilfried Tsonga looked ready to pack his bags with Denis Shapovalov up 5-2 in the fifth set, while Caroline Wozniacki was facing a 5-1 and match point deficit against Jana Fett. Both would emerge victorious.

While experience won out for those two, a budding new star named Marta Kostyuk has made a dream come true on a qualifying wildcard. The 2017 junior Australian Open champion set up an all-Ukrainian third-round showdown with No. 4 seed Elina Svitolina.
